Elasticsearch-head 插件编译源码包下载与安装指南

需积分: 28 13 下载量 169 浏览量 更新于2024-10-26 收藏 35.98MB GZ 举报
资源摘要信息:"elasticsearch-head-compile-after.tar.gz" ### 知识点: #### 1. Elasticsearch 概述 Elasticsearch 是一个基于 Lucene 的开源搜索引擎,旨在快速、可靠地处理大量数据,并提供实时搜索功能。它被设计为易于扩展,可以通过分布式集群进行水平扩展,以提供高可用性和容错能力。Elasticsearch 使用了一种名为倒排索引的数据结构,这使得它在执行全文搜索时非常高效。 #### 2. Elasticsearch Head 插件 Elasticsearch Head 是一个常用的 Elasticsearch 管理和监控插件,它提供了一个直观的Web界面,用于与Elasticsearch集群交互。通过该插件,用户可以查看集群状态、索引信息、节点信息以及执行各种管理操作,比如创建和删除索引、设置映射、调整分片等。它还提供了对Elasticsearch查询功能的支持,允许用户执行查询并查看结果。 #### 3. 编译 Elasticsearch Head 源码包 提到的文件名为 "elasticsearch-head-compile-after.tar.gz",意味着这是已经编译完成的Elasticsearch Head源码包。Elasticsearch Head 插件最初是用CoffeeScript 编写的,通常需要编译成JavaScript 以便在浏览器中运行。编译过程涉及到构建工具,例如Grunt 或 Gulp,以及可能需要的依赖项,如 Node.js 和 npm(Node.js 包管理器)。 #### 4. 安装 Elasticsearch Head 插件教程 为了配合 "elasticsearch-head-compile-after.tar.gz" 的使用,建议参照《如何安装 elasticsearch-head 插件?》的安装教程。该教程将详细指导如何安装和配置Elasticsearch Head 插件。通常情况下,安装步骤包括: - 确保Elasticsearch集群已经正确运行。 - 下载并解压已编译的Elasticsearch Head源码包。 - 可能需要修改配置文件,比如设置集群地址。 - 启动Elasticsearch Head 插件。 #### 5. Elasticsearch 与 Elasticsearch Head 的关系 Elasticsearch Head 不是Elasticsearch的官方组件,而是社区开发的一个独立工具,为了管理Elasticsearch集群而设计。它与Elasticsearch的主程序是分开的,可以看作是Elasticsearch的一个扩展功能。因此,它必须单独安装并运行。 #### 6. 使用场景 Elasticsearch Head 插件适用于多种场景,尤其适合于需要通过图形界面来监控和管理Elasticsearch集群的开发者和运维人员。它可以帮助用户快速理解集群状态、执行基本的维护工作,以及在开发或测试环境中进行实时的索引查询和分析。 #### 7. 注意事项 在使用Elasticsearch Head 插件时,需要考虑以下几点: - 确保Elasticsearch集群是安全配置的,避免未授权访问导致安全风险。 - 对于生产环境,最好使用官方支持的集群管理工具。 - 理解Elasticsearch Head 只是一个视图和管理工具,它不会替代Elasticsearch集群本身的功能。 - 在使用Elasticsearch Head 插件时,需注意其兼容性问题,确保插件与Elasticsearch版本的兼容。 #### 8. Elasticsearch 版本和插件兼容性 Elasticsearch 的不同版本可能对插件有着不同的支持和兼容要求。因此,在安装和使用Elasticsearch Head 插件之前,需要检查其与当前使用的Elasticsearch版本是否兼容。可以从Elasticsearch官方网站或社区论坛获取最新版本信息和插件兼容性说明。 通过以上的知识点,我们可以了解到 "elasticsearch-head-compile-after.tar.gz" 文件是Elasticsearch Head 插件编译后的文件,它将作为管理Elasticsearch集群的一个重要工具。配合详尽的安装教程,这个工具可以帮助我们更高效地管理和优化Elasticsearch集群。